United (UCB) market outlook | technical breakout patterns, growth opportunities, earnings forecasts. United Community Banks Inc. (UCB) closed at $32.95, down 0.45% on the session. The stock remains within a well-defined trading range, with support near $31.3 and resistance at $34.6. Today’s modest decline reflects a broader pause as the market digests recent sector movements.

Volume during today’s session was in line with recent averages, suggesting no panic selling or unusual accumulation. The 0.45% drop is relatively mild compared to the broader regional banking sector, which has faced mixed sentiment amid shifting interest rate expectations. United Community Banks, headquartered in Georgia, operates primarily in the southeastern U.S., a region with steady economic activity. The bank’s deposit base and loan portfolio have benefited from a stable local economy, but rising operational costs and margin compression remain headwinds that investors continue to monitor. Today’s price action may reflect profit-taking after a modest rally earlier in the week, as the stock has been oscillating between support and resistance for several weeks. The absence of company-specific news suggests the move is driven by broader market flows rather than a fundamental shift in UCB’s outlook. Short-term momentum appears neutral, with the stock positioned near the middle of its recent range. This approach balances systematic strategies with real-time responsiveness. From a technical perspective, UCB is trading near the midpoint of its established support-resistance band. The support level at $31.3 has held firm in recent months, providing a floor during pullbacks, while resistance at $34.6 has capped rallies. The stock’s 50-day moving average is currently in the low-$33 area, slightly above the current price, indicating near-term overhead pressure. Momentum indicators are mixed: the Relative Strength Index (RSI) is in the mid-40s, suggesting neither overbought nor oversold conditions. The MACD line is hovering near its signal line, reflecting a lack of clear directional bias. Price action has formed a series of lower highs over the past three weeks, hinting at potential weakness, but the ability to hold above $32.50 has prevented a breakdown. A decisive move above $34.6 would signal a bullish breakout, while a drop below $31.3 could open the door to further downside toward the $30 area. Looking ahead, UCB’s direction may be influenced by upcoming economic data, particularly inflation reports and Fed policy signals, which could shift interest rate expectations and affect net interest margins. Earnings season for regional banks is approaching, and UCB’s results will be closely watched for loan growth trends and credit quality. If the stock can reclaim the $33.50 level, it could build momentum toward testing resistance at $34.6. Conversely, a break below $32 could lead to a retest of the $31.3 support. The current technical setup suggests a period of consolidation may persist, with potential catalysts from either sector-wide sentiment or company-specific developments. Investors should remain attentive to volume patterns: a significant increase on a breakout or breakdown would lend credibility to the move. Overall, UCB appears to be in a holding pattern, awaiting a clearer catalyst to determine its next direction.
